Director, Growth and Performance Marketing, MyRecipes (Web/App)

Job Description

About The Position | Major goals and objectives and location requirements

The Director of Growth & Performance Marketing will lead efforts to drive growth of MyRecipes through performance marketing, such as through paid acquisition and external amplification. The role will focus on closing new distribution/acquisition sources through partnerships, driving alternative traction for web and app through paid spend that validates messaging, and amplifying top organic content.

About The Team | The Team and/or Brand.

People Inc. has the largest and most iconic portfolio of food brands in the US, reaching and engaging over 80M+ consumers each month across our websites, including Allrecipes, Food & Wine, EatingWell, Serious Eats, Simply Recipes and more.  Your role will be part of MyRecipes, a unique digital offering where registered users can save and curate personalized recipe collections from across all of the People Inc. food and home brands, and beyond. This is just the beginning of our next-generation digital food experience as we build out meal planning, shopping, and so much more.

About The Positions Contributions:

Weight % Accountabilities, Actions and Expected Measurable Results

  • 25%:  Performance Marketing: own day-to-day execution of paid channels, media spend, and bidding strategies to optimize Cost Per Acquisition (CAC)

  • 25%:  Growth Strategy: develop and execute full-funnel marketing strategies to improve user acquisition and retention.

  • 20%:  Data & Analytics: track key growth metrics (ROI, LTV: CAC) and manage a "single source of truth" for performance reporting.

  • 10%:  Experimentation: run A/B testing on creative, audience targeting, and landing pages to boost conversions.

  • 10%:  Partnerships: build a formidable pipeline and help execute distribution partnerships for web, app, and paid membership offerings.

  • 10%:  Cross-Functional Collaboration: work closely with product, sales, and engineering teams to align marketing efforts with overall business objectives.

What We Do

People Inc. is America’s largest digital and print publisher. Our 40+ iconic and fast-growing brands harness the best intent-driven content, the fastest sites, and the fewest ads to help nearly 200 million people every month, including 95 percent of US women, make decisions, take action, and find inspiration. People Inc. brands include PEOPLE, Better Homes & Gardens, Verywell, FOOD & WINE, The Spruce, Allrecipes, Byrdie, REAL SIMPLE, Investopedia, Southern Living and more.
